## v1.9.4 — Reminder Job Hardening

The Carewell appointment reminder job was updated ahead of the security review. Changes: patient identifiers are no longer written to job logs; message templates exclude diagnosis fields; the scheduler now runs under a least-privilege service account; and outbound SMS requests are signed and rate-limited. Failed sends retry three times with backoff, then land in a quarantined queue reviewed weekly. Security questions about this release should go to the responsible engineer.

account owner for bawip-tahag: Raleth Quenok

## Tuning: Sort Stability

Quick context for review: Reportloom's column sorter used to fall back to an unstable quicksort above a size threshold, which shuffled equal-keyed rows between runs and made diff-based report comparisons useless. We now force a stable merge path, but that costs memory, so there are thresholds controlling when we switch strategies and how big the merge buffer gets. If you're reviewing a change to these, please run the golden-report diff suite first. The current constants are listed right below.

tuning table, faduf-baduf:
PRIORITIES = {
    "ulavan": 191,
    "silys": 750,
    "goriel": 238,
    "kelmir": 66,
    "wendor": 432,
}

Capacity note: Lumora SDK parity. The Kestrel (Java) and Plover (Swift) clients now expose the same batching API, but default buffer sizes differ, which skews load on the ingest tier. Maintainers: do not bump one client's limits without mirroring the other, or the Tarn gateway shards unevenly under peak. Parity tests live in the cross-client suite; run them before any constant change. Budget assumes 40k events/s aggregate across both SDKs. The constants both clients must share are as follows.

tuning constants:
QUOTAS = {
    "druwyn": 5,
    "holix": 5,
    "zorath": 5,
    "holwyn": 10,
}